@NotDonna I made a lovely dish with chicken yesterday, that could easily be made with cod:

Fry bacon lardons until brown - set aside
Fry cod in the same pan until cooked - set aside
Add mushrooms and a few sliced baby plum tomatoes to the pan, fry until browned.
Add a squeeze of garlic, and cook for 1 minute
Add a couple of handfuls of spinach and wilt.
Pour in double cream and bubble for 3 minutes until slightly thickened.
Add grated cheese (cheddar or parmesan) to thicken the sauce

Serve cod and bacon in sauce.
